hicken is a healthy choice and did you know that chicken gizzards are one of the most nutritious parts of the chicken? Very high in protein, low in fat and many vitamins and minerals (including B12 - good for your brian health). Besides all that, the bonus is that they also are very tasty!!
Chicken Gizzards
Ingredients
• About 1 ½ lbs of chicken gizzards
• 3 TBSP extra virgin olive oil (EVOO)
• 1 clove of garlic, minced
• 1 large onion (preferably sweet onion, but not essential) sliced thin, then diced (yield should be about 1 to 1 ½ cups)
• ½ cup of dry white vermouth (or dry white wine)
• 1 ½ TSP paprika
• ½ TSP curry powder (optional but highly suggest using it)
• ½ TSP tobacco sauce (or to taste) (alternate - use a chili pepper or chili flakes)
• Salt to taste
• Optional - more vermouth or wine to de-glaze frying pan
Method
• Wash gizzards in cold tap water and pat them dry - set aside
• Put EVOO in a frying pan and add garlic - cook 30 seconds
• Add onions and cook till translucent
• Add vermouth (or wine) and cook 1 minute
• Add paprika, curry powder, and tobacco sauce, stir in to incorporate all ingredients, cook for a minute or 2
• Add gizzards, and toss them/mix them, to ensure they are all coated
• Continue to fry on med heat, stirring every so often, until cooked
• Remove from pan and into your serving platter
• Optional: add a bit of vermouth back into your pan and on low/medium heat, deglaze pan and then pour all that de-glazed flavor over the cooked gizzards
• Enjoy
